How a Treasury buyback tweak helped bitcoin surge 25% to nearly $80,000 in days
price
U.S. Treasury buyback tweaks—described by analysts as not QE—pulled long-term yields off 19‑year highs and triggered a record short squeeze that sent Bitcoin up ~25% to nearly $80,000 in days. The move highlights BTC’s acute sensitivity to Treasury/Fed liquidity and yield shifts and the outsized impact of flow-driven squeezes on leveraged positions.
